At its core, sound healing operates on the principle of entrainment: your brainwaves naturally synchronize with external rhythmic frequencies. When you're exposed to specific sound frequencies, your neural activity shifts to match that vibration. A 40 Hz frequency (associated with focus and gamma brain waves) produces different nervous system outcomes than a 7 Hz frequency (associated with deep relaxation and theta brain waves). Researchers at institutions like the UC Irvine Medical Center have documented measurable changes in heart rate variability, cortisol levels, and parasympathetic activation within 15-30 minutes of sound healing exposure.
The most researched modalities include binaural beats (stereo sounds that create frequency differences your brain interprets as a single tone), isochronic tones (pulsing sounds at specific intervals), and tuning fork therapy (precise vibrational frequencies applied to the body). Crystal bowls, which gained popularity through yoga studios, work similarly through harmonic resonance. A 432 Hz frequency, marketed as the "universal healing frequency," shows promise in preliminary studies for reducing anxiety, though much of the marketing around it exceeds current scientific evidence.
What makes sound healing distinct from simply "listening to music" is intentionality and precision. A curated 10-minute isochronic tone session designed for parasympathetic activation differs substantially from background music, which often contains unpredictable frequency shifts. Your vagus nerve—the primary conduit of parasympathetic signaling—responds to stable, predictable sound patterns. This is why therapeutic sound protocols maintain consistent frequencies rather than varied melodies.
In 2026, sound healing has integrated into clinical settings for anxiety management, chronic pain, and insomnia. Some hospitals now offer tuning fork sessions alongside conventional treatment, and sleep clinics increasingly recommend binaural beat tracks as a non-pharmaceutical sleep aid. The advantage over herbal remedies or pharmaceuticals is immediate accessibility—you need only a smartphone and headphones to begin experiencing effects.
For practical implementation, start with 10-minute sessions of binaural beats at 7 Hz (theta frequency) for relaxation, or 40 Hz for cognitive clarity. Apps like Insight Timer and BrainWave have expanded their catalogs to include legitimate sound healing protocols alongside meditation. For deeper work, consider a professional tuning fork session ($60-150 per session) where practitioners apply calibrated forks to specific body points and meridians.
The key caveat: sound healing works best as a complement to, not replacement for, clinical care. Its documented benefits for nervous system regulation make it valuable for stress management and sleep optimization, but it shouldn't substitute for therapy in cases of clinical anxiety or depression.
